What's the name of the gin, lemon juice, and carbonated water cocktail first mentioned by Jerry Thomas, the father of American mixology?
Answer Tom Collins
The Tom Collins is a gin, lemon juice, sugar, and carbonated water cocktail, and was first recorded in writing in 1876 by Jerry Thomas, who was known as the father of American mixology. It's usually served in a Collins glass over ice.
